Breaking Down the Terms: What “Claim and Keep” Actually Means
Let’s get granular. A typical “70 free spins no deposit Australia 2026 claim and keep” offer looks like this in real life.
| Term | Typical Value |
|---|---|
| Number of Spins | 70 |
| Game Restriction | Usually one pokie (e.g., Big Bass Bonanza) |
| Wagering Requirement | 35x to 45x on the winnings from spins |
| Max Cashout | $100 to $150 AUD |
| Time Limit | 24 to 72 hours to use spins and meet wagering |
So if you win $50 from those spins, you might need to wager $50 x 35 = $1,750 before you can withdraw. That sounds huge. But if you hit a big win, say $200, the math changes. You might still walk away with cash after meeting the playthrough.
The “claim and keep” part means the spins themselves are free. You don’t deposit. You just register and spin. Any cash left after wagering is yours. That’s the core promise.
How to Maximize Your 70 Free Spins No Deposit (A Practical Guide)
I’ve messed up plenty of bonuses by being careless. Here is a short strategy to actually cash out from a “70 free spins no deposit australia 2026 claim and keep” deal.
- Check the game: Always play the exact pokie listed. Do not switch games. Winnings from other pokies might be voided.
- Bet low: Most free spins have a fixed bet value (like $0.10 per spin). You cannot change it. So just let them run.
- Watch the clock: You often have 24 hours. Do not delay. Spin them immediately.
- Meet wagering on low volatility: If you have to wager $1,000, do it on a low-volatility pokie. It’s boring, but it preserves your balance. High-volatility games can wipe you out before you finish the playthrough.
This is not complicated. It just requires discipline. Most people lose because they ignore the time limit or play the wrong game.
